The 18-hole Lilac Golf Course in Newport, MI is a public golf course that opened in 1960. Designed by Sam and Alex Lilac, Lilac Golf Course measures 6941 yards from the longest tees and has a slope rating of 130 and a 73.8 USGA rating. The course features 5 sets of tees for different skill levels. The greens are bent grass and the fairways are bluegrass.

Since the Thorne family took Lilac over, it has gotten a little better every season. They have continued to make improvements every season without raising rates.
The course may be flat as many have noted, but play from the Black tees and tell me it's boring. You'll be to busy just trying to make pars, she's very long at 6,941 yds. from the tips. Unless you're a bomber hitting 280 yds. plus, good luck!
Lilac will give you a good challenge.
All in all for the price, how accommodating the staff is, and over all playability. Lilac is a great public course for the price.
